首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ql数据库中eof

EOF (End of File) 是一个特殊的标记,用于表示文件的结束。在 MySQL 数据库中,EOF 主要用于表示 SQL 语句的结束。当向 MySQL 发送一条 SQL 语句时,可以通过在语句末尾添加 EOF 标记来告诉 MySQL 这条语句已经结束。

EOF 的作用是告诉 MySQL 在处理输入时停止读取语句,开始执行之前输入的语句。使用 EOF 标记可以方便地批量执行多条 SQL 语句,特别是在脚本文件中。

MySQL 数据库中 EOF 的使用示例:

  1. 使用命令行工具执行 SQL 语句:
代码语言:txt
复制
mysql -u username -p
Enter password: 
Welcome to the MySQL monitor.  Commands end with ; or \g.
Your MySQL connection id is XXXX
Server version: X.X.X

mysql> USE database_name;
mysql> SELECT * FROM table_name;
mysql> EOF

在这个示例中,使用 mysql -u username -p 命令登录到 MySQL 数据库,然后输入 USE database_name;SELECT * FROM table_name; 两条 SQL 语句,最后使用 EOF 标记告诉 MySQL 结束输入。MySQL 会根据 EOF 标记来判断输入的语句是否结束,并执行之前输入的语句。

  1. 在脚本文件中执行 SQL 语句:
代码语言:txt
复制
mysql -u username -p < script.sql

在这个示例中,将 SQL 语句保存在 script.sql 文件中,然后使用 mysql -u username -p < script.sql 命令将文件作为输入传递给 MySQL 执行。在 script.sql 文件的末尾使用 EOF 标记告诉 MySQL 结束输入。

MySQL 数据库中 EOF 的应用场景包括:

  1. 执行批量 SQL 语句:使用 EOF 标记可以方便地执行包含多条 SQL 语句的脚本文件,例如数据库初始化脚本、数据导入脚本等。
  2. 交互式命令行操作:在命令行工具中,使用 EOF 标记可以告诉 MySQL 结束输入,方便进行交互式操作。
  3. 自动化脚本:在自动化脚本中,可以使用 EOF 标记来指示 MySQL 执行特定的 SQL 语句,实现定时任务、数据备份等功能。

腾讯云的相关产品和产品介绍链接地址如下:

以上是关于 MySQL 数据库中 EOF 的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券